Some attorneys use tiered contingency charge frameworks, where the portion enhances as the case progresses. As an example, they may anticipate 30% for a quick negotiation, 35% if the case mosts likely to arbitration, and 40% if it reaches trial. Some may charge greater fees based upon danger, and others may frequently take a smaller charge. The basis of reverse backup arrangements gets on just how much the client stayed clear of loss. As an example, image a defendant who was issued for $2.7 million, however his attorney bargains a negotiation for only $100,000. A reverse contingent cost would provide the defense lawyer a cut of the financial savings of $2.6 million.
